Chain Snatchers On Bike Flee With Six Tola Gold Chain In Medak

Medak/Hyderabad, Mar 13 (Maxim News): Two persons on a bike snatched a six-tola gold mangalsutra of an elderly woman at Yellamma Colony in Toopran town on Thursday morning.

The victim, Rangamma (68), was sweeping the premises of her house when the bike-borne men wearing helmets reached there. When they first tried to snatch the chain, she confronted them. They then held her mouth shut and snatched the chain before speeding away

Upon hearing Rangamma crying, the neighbors came out of their houses and made a futile attempt to catch them. Inspector Rangakrishna and his team visited the spot.  (Maxim News)
